Output 8e629c1439fe10b8c226e63552c5d752e9c42e3c91f96951e6c03a0255f36102:0

value
92600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a296711f963069bbe5fafd2a0447f31dff76269 OP_EQUAL
address
39ukLWhPcrLWJHoeYVV2iNbLdh4ktudPJQ
transaction
8e629c1439fe10b8c226e63552c5d752e9c42e3c91f96951e6c03a0255f36102
confirmations
393239
spent
true